Produktbeschreibung
Poetry is notoriously known for being romantic and beautiful. Author Tiffany Simone says she prefers to surprise people with her words, to shock their senses. With her fourth book, she continues to do just that. Awful Lovely is perhaps Dirty Sweet Poetry's most stripped-down poetic collection to date. Writing as Dirty Sweet Poetry since 2015, Tiffany's ability to swing from endearing to erotic makes her relatable. She invites you in, and slams you up against the wall with a fury that is somehow both gentle and rough. "It's always been about a sense of duality- the yin and the yang. It's my trying (and failing) to find that balance within. I've never been all or nothing. I swear I live in a gray area."Everyone has multiple sides to them to some extent. Relationships bring out the light and the dark, our beauty along with our demons. We can be the very worst versions of ourselves yet, look pretty while doing it. Fear will make us run. Fear can make us stay. Love paints gorgeous futures. Love can ruin your life. Awful Lovely continues the Dirty Sweet name but shows a darker side. It's the things we don't dare say out loud. Running and coming home, or is it... coming home and then running away? As the author says, it has always been about duality, hence the Dirty Sweet name. "The writer in me turns pretty on paper. I will wear baby pink when I hurt you."-Tiffany Simone
